Egnyte Product Manager Salary Overview

Product Manager salaries at Egnyte are competitive within the tech industry, reflecting the company's commitment to attracting and retaining top talent. As of 2025, the general salary range for PMs at Egnyte spans from $110,000 for entry-level positions to over $250,000 for senior roles, not including bonuses and equity compensation.

Several factors influence individual PM salaries at Egnyte:

  • Experience level and expertise in content management and security
  • Performance and impact on product success
  • Location (with adjustments for cost of living)
  • Educational background and relevant certifications

Compared to industry standards, Egnyte's PM compensation tends to be on par with other mid-sized tech companies, though it may not always match the top-tier salaries offered by tech giants like Google or Facebook. However, Egnyte often compensates for this with generous equity packages and a strong focus on work-life balance.

Understanding Egnyte's PM Compensation Structure

Egnyte's PM compensation package is designed to be competitive and rewarding, consisting of several key components:

  1. Base Salary: This forms the foundation of the compensation package, typically ranging from $110,000 to $250,000+ depending on the PM's level and experience.

  2. Annual Bonus: Egnyte offers performance-based bonuses, usually ranging from 10% to 25% of the base salary. These bonuses are tied to individual, team, and company-wide performance metrics.

  3. Equity Compensation: Stock options or Restricted Stock Units (RSUs) are a significant part of Egnyte's PM compensation. The company typically offers a four-year vesting schedule with a one-year cliff.

  4. Benefits and Perks: Egnyte provides a comprehensive benefits package including:

    • Health, dental, and vision insurance
    • 401(k) matching
    • Flexible work arrangements
    • Professional development budget
    • Generous paid time off

The combination of these elements creates a well-rounded compensation package designed to attract and retain top PM talent while aligning individual success with company growth.

Egnyte Product Manager Salaries by Level

Egnyte's PM career ladder consists of several levels, each with its own salary range and compensation structure. Here's a detailed breakdown:

Level Base Salary Range Target Bonus Equity Grant (4-year)
Associate PM $110,000 - $130,000 10% $50,000 - $100,000
Product Manager $130,000 - $170,000 15% $100,000 - $200,000
Senior PM $170,000 - $220,000 20% $200,000 - $400,000
Principal PM $220,000 - $250,000 25% $400,000 - $600,000
Director of Product $250,000+ 30%+ $600,000+

Associate/Junior PM

  • Typically 0-2 years of experience
  • Focus on learning and supporting senior PMs
  • May lead smaller features or components

Product Manager

  • 2-5 years of experience
  • Owns medium-sized products or significant features
  • Collaborates across teams and influences product direction

Senior PM

  • 5-8 years of experience
  • Leads major products or product lines
  • Significant influence on product strategy and roadmap

Principal PM

  • 8+ years of experience
  • Drives complex, cross-functional initiatives
  • Mentors junior PMs and shapes product vision

Director of Product

  • 10+ years of experience
  • Sets overall product strategy and vision
  • Manages a team of PMs and interfaces with executive leadership

It's important to note that these ranges can vary based on individual performance, market conditions, and specific expertise in Egnyte's core areas of content management and security.

How Location Affects Egnyte PM Salaries

Egnyte, headquartered in Mountain View, California, adjusts PM salaries based on location to account for cost of living differences:

  • Silicon Valley: Base salaries are typically highest here, serving as the benchmark for other locations.
  • Other Major Tech Hubs (e.g., New York, Seattle): Salaries are usually 90-95% of Silicon Valley rates.
  • Secondary Tech Markets (e.g., Austin, Denver): Approximately 80-85% of Silicon Valley rates.
  • Remote Work: Egnyte offers flexible remote work options, with salaries adjusted based on the employee's location, typically ranging from 70-90% of Silicon Valley rates.

Internationally, Egnyte maintains offices in Poland and the UK, with PM salaries competitive for those markets but generally lower than US rates when converted to USD.

Career Progression and Salary Growth

Career progression at Egnyte follows a structured path, with opportunities for salary growth tied to promotions and performance:

  1. Associate PM → PM: Typically occurs after 2-3 years, with a 15-25% salary increase.
  2. PM → Senior PM: Usually takes 3-4 years, accompanied by a 20-30% salary bump.
  3. Senior PM → Principal PM: This leap often requires 4-5 years at the Senior level and comes with a 15-25% raise.
  4. Principal PM → Director: The most significant jump, often seeing a 30%+ increase in total compensation.

Egnyte encourages continuous learning and development, offering resources and mentorship to help PMs advance their careers. Performance reviews are conducted bi-annually, with opportunities for off-cycle promotions for exceptional performers.

Negotiating Your Egnyte PM Offer

When negotiating your Egnyte PM offer, consider these tips:

  1. Research thoroughly: Understand Egnyte's position in the market and benchmark against similar companies.
  2. Focus on total compensation: Don't fixate solely on base salary; consider the value of equity and benefits.
  3. Highlight unique skills: Emphasize any specialized knowledge in content management or security that aligns with Egnyte's focus.
  4. Be prepared to justify: Back up your requests with data on market rates and your specific value add.

Typically, base salary and equity are the most negotiable aspects of an Egnyte offer. Avoid pushing too hard on multiple components simultaneously, and remember that Egnyte values long-term commitment and cultural fit.

FAQs

How often does Egnyte review and adjust PM salaries?

Egnyte typically conducts annual salary reviews, with adjustments based on individual performance, market conditions, and company performance. However, high performers may see off-cycle raises or promotions.

Does Egnyte offer sign-on bonuses for new PM hires?

While not standard, Egnyte may offer sign-on bonuses for senior PM roles or candidates with highly sought-after skills. These bonuses usually range from $10,000 to $50,000, depending on the seniority of the position.

How does Egnyte's PM compensation compare to other content management companies?

Egnyte's compensation is generally competitive with other mid-sized content management companies like Box or Dropbox. While base salaries might be slightly lower than those offered by larger tech companies, Egnyte often makes up for this with generous equity packages and a strong emphasis on work-life balance.

What benefits does Egnyte offer to support PM career development?

Egnyte provides several benefits for PM career development, including:

  • Annual professional development budget ($2,000-$5,000)
  • Mentorship programs pairing junior PMs with senior leaders
  • Regular "PM Days" for skill-sharing and networking
  • Opportunities to attend industry conferences and workshops
